Residential building permits · 2015–2025
| Year | Units | Valuation |
|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 39 | $7,737,021 |
| 2024 | 31 | $5,405,034 |
| 2023 | 42 | $6,664,824 |
| 2022 | 34 | $4,844,788 |
| 2021 | 35 | $4,442,885 |
| 2020 | 45 | $4,797,148 |
| 2019 | 35 | $3,748,300 |
| 2018 | 20 | $2,194,676 |
| 2017 | 18 | $1,975,208 |
| 2016 | 16 | $1,755,740 |
| 2015 | 35 | $4,098,205 |
The Census Building Permits Survey counts new privately-owned housing units authorized by building permits — a leading indicator of housing supply. "1-unit" is single-family; "5+ units" is larger multifamily. Figures are imputation-adjusted to cover permit offices that did not report.
